In 30 seconds

  • Start with order sources and production—not the cash drawer.
  • Make vendors demonstrate your hardest modifiers, table flow, refunds and delivery edge cases.
  • “Offline” never means every external service continues unchanged.
  • Ask who supplies, installs, monitors and supports every device.
  • Compare the full configured cost across locations, terminals, KDS screens, processing, add-ons and implementation.

What a hospitality POS must do after “send”

A restaurant POS is an operational router. It may receive walk-in, phone, table and online orders; carry menu choices and modifiers; coordinate production; accept payment; control protected actions; and leave a record that managers can reconcile later.

Order entryFast visual menu, modifiers, customer context and fulfilment choices
ProductionKitchen display, dockets, routing and order-status clarity
PaymentSupported terminals, refunds, permissions and settlement visibility
DeliveryAddress, zone, fee, driver assignment, dispatch and status workflows
ManagementMenu, trading controls, customer context, reports and multi-site visibility
ContinuityDocumented local behaviour, recovery and connectivity dependencies

The best-looking terminal can still be the wrong system if it turns online orders into manual work, sends incomplete instructions to the kitchen or makes support a three-company diagnosis.

What “offline” should actually mean

Offline claims are easy to overread. A POS may continue taking some local orders while payment authorisation, cloud menu updates, maps, delivery services, messaging or multi-location reporting remain dependent on connectivity. Recovery behaviour matters too: which transactions queue, which do not, and what staff see when the connection returns?

Lightspeed, Square, Toast and Oolio/OrderMate also publish offline or on-premise continuity claims. No responsible buyer should award “most reliable” from that label alone.

Run a controlled continuity drill in the demo

  1. Start an in-store and online order.
  2. Interrupt the venue connection at an agreed point.
  3. Observe order entry, kitchen output, payment, customer status and staff warnings.
  4. Restore the connection and inspect reconciliation.
  5. Write down which external services behaved differently and why.

A 20-minute POS demo script

  1. Build the ugly product. Half-half, extras, removed ingredients, allergen context and a price-changing option.
  2. Enter it four ways. Walk-in, phone, table and online where supported.
  3. Send it to production. Check KDS, printer routing, timing and docket readability.
  4. Change the service state. Sell out an item, add a surcharge, alter a trading window and protect the action.
  5. Handle the exception. Change fulfilment, partially refund, move a delivery and find the audit trail.
  6. Close the loop. Locate the order, payment, settlement, customer context and manager report later.

If the vendor cannot demonstrate one realistic service sequence, another hundred feature ticks will not make the workflow clearer.
